Specifications: Punica Granatum Seed Oil
Application
The oil is obtained by cold-pressing the seeds of the fruit. It is particularly suitable for mature, acne-prone, and vascular skin. It has high bioactivity; it is not used as a base oil but rather as an active ingredient in cosmetic formulas at a concentration of 5-10% (for spot applications, 50-90%). It can be used in combination with other oils or hyaluronic acid – apply such a blend to the face as a regenerating facial oil. Perfect for enriching cream or balm formulations. Add a few drops of oil to the cosmetic and mix. The oil can be used as body oil (e.g., when mixed with almond oil), hair end serum, or for nails. You can add a few drops of oil to your chosen scrub (e.g., blackcurrant seed scrub).

Benefits
- Strong antioxidant, anti-inflammatory, and antiseptic properties.
- Inhibits pro-inflammatory enzyme activity, beneficial for inflammatory skin conditions such as acne and supports healing.
- Stimulates epidermal cell division and inhibits new blood vessel formation (reduces erythema), ideal for people with vascular skin or rosacea.
- Stimulates collagen production.
- Contains estrogens and phytoestrogens, which firm the skin and reduce fine lines (can also help relieve some menopause symptoms).
- Rich in polyphenols (antioxidants) and gamma-tocopherol (a form of vitamin E suitable for mature skin – improves tone, firmness, and elasticity).
- Strong anti-aging effect.
